Output 86ea139e556c5737fa140c57b1b17d4a2acbaf81bced7037f307400da0e70e62:0

value
24323009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b6f41f19c09f4527d9d8557fa9ead91f712db6 OP_EQUAL
address
MTf3MhpDu2LDKY81NUCSS98ZSwma5Nq4WT
transaction
86ea139e556c5737fa140c57b1b17d4a2acbaf81bced7037f307400da0e70e62
spent
true